Birmingham Museum of Art
Museum Information

General Admission

General admission to the Museum is free of charge. Admission to Pompeii: Tales from an Eruption is $16 for adults; $14 for visitors in groups of 10 or more, college students with ID, and seniors over age 65; $8 for children under age 12 accompanied by an adult. Tickets are $8 at the door for active members of the U.S. military with ID. Admission includes an audio tour.

Location

The Birmingham Museum of Art is located in downtown Birmingham. The building sits on the corner of Richard Arrington, Jr. Boulevard and 8th Avenue North. The Museum is easy to reach from I-65, I-20/59 and Highways 280 and 31.

Parking

Free parking is available in the Museum lot located off of Richard Arrington, Jr. Boulevard directly behind the Museum. There are designated spaces for those with disabilities. Additional parking for a small fee is available in the nearby Boutwell Parking Deck or in public parking under the interstate viaducts on 9th Avenue North.

Special Needs

The Museum is fully equipped to welcome all visitors. Special needs are met on arrival with designated parking spaces and ground level entrance from the parking lot. A limited number of wheelchairs and assisted listening devices (for programs in Steiner Auditorium) are available at the security station located at the entrance from the parking lot.
